DITTER, J., October 1, 1969.
This case deals with an arbitration provision found in the uninsured motorists portion of an insurance contract. The question is whether a dispute arising from the cancellation of the policy for the purported nonpayment of a premium is a matter which must be submitted to arbitration.
Plaintiffs, Suzanne McGrorty and her mother, Bernadette Fenoglio, were involved in an automobile accident on February 2, 1966, with an uninsured driver...
